INTANGIBLE ETHNO-CULTURAL HERITAGE OF RUSSIAN REGIONS IN THE CONTEXT OF MEDIA LAW
Abstract
This article examines the challenge of safeguarding the intangible ethno-cultural heritage of Russian regions in the sphere of media law. The analysis considers intellectual property law, state-legislation, and inheritance as mechanisms for ensuring intergenerational transmission. Additionally, the paper devotes a specific section to the safeguarding of ethno-cultural patrimony at the global level, within the framework of international initiatives protecting the intangible cultural heritage. Special attention is given to traditional knowledge and traditional cultural expressions as objects of intellectual property rights, as well as the distinctions between them and intangible cultural heritage. The text stresses the significance of preserving cultural heritage for the well-being of humanity in both the present and the future. Additionally, the author examines the issue of the ethno-cultural patrimony in the Orel region as an illustration of the challenges facing cultural heritage preservation in Russia. This article addresses the contemporary discourse surrounding the challenges of conserving cultural legacy and traditional knowledge in Russia and the world.
